Bespoke content, researched and built for your business

Every programme starts with research rather than a template. We survey your team and interview your leaders and your top performers to identify what your best people already do that works, then codify it into a standard the whole team can run. On top of that we layer our own frameworks and experience, built around your real deals, your deal sizes, your industry and your buyers. You get your own best practice made repeatable, strengthened by expertise you do not have in-house.

No slides. Every concept applied to a live deal

There is no PowerPoint. Each concept is taught, then applied straight away to one of the rep’s own open accounts, then captured into their own 90-day action plan. Modules are capped so people absorb and apply rather than sit through a lecture, and between sessions the practice happens on real accounts.

A manager embed plan, so it survives the day

Your managers leave with a plan for reinforcing the programme, not a hope that it sticks. That matters because reinforcement is the variable: Murre and Dros, publishing their replication of the Ebbinghaus forgetting curve in PLOS ONE in 2015, confirmed that most of what is learned is lost inside the first day unless it is revisited.

Feedback forms are not evidence.

Most sales certificates are issued on the last day of the programme. They record that a person attended. They tell you nothing about how that person will run a deal in March.

Klozers certification is issued 90 days later, on evidence of what a salesperson did in their own accounts.

Nobody finishes the programme with nothing. Candidate is awarded on Day 2 for completing the work. Certified is earned at Day 90, on evidence.

Enablement led

Technology and SaaS company

96 salespeople, 7 languages

Deployed during the annual sales kickoff. During the debrief, leadership found that 40% of pipeline consisted of deals that should have been exited months earlier.

Sales leadership led

Distribution company

23 channel managers

Introduced to move a tenured team out of reactive selling and dated technique, by having them work their own live accounts rather than generic exercises.
